async def _drain_watch_notifications(self, completion_queue) -> None:
"""Consume queued watch events and inject them when notifications are enabled.
The queue is ALWAYS drained (so watch events don't rot or requeue-spin)
but injection is skipped entirely when
``display.background_process_notifications`` is ``off`` (#9290).
"""
watch_events = _drain_gateway_watch_events(completion_queue)
if self._load_background_notifications_mode() == "off":
return
for evt in watch_events:
synth_text = _format_gateway_process_notification(evt)
if not synth_text:
continue
try:
await self._inject_watch_notification(synth_text, evt)
except Exception as exc:
logger.error("Watch notification injection error: %s", exc)
